Description

The vulnerability allows a remote non-authenticated attacker to read and manipulate data.

Open redirect vulnerability in EMC RSA Authentication Manager 8.x before 8.1 Patch 6 allows remote attackers to redirect users to arbitrary web sites and conduct phishing attacks via unspecified vectors. <a href="http://cwe.mitre.org/data/definitions/601.html">CWE-601: URL Redirection to Untrusted Site ('Open Redirect')</a>
